Chapter 1:Product Description
Features:
The PDI (Parallel Digital Interface) Deluxe Card is not only designed to work with the Realmagic Xcard or 100% compatible MPEG2/MPEG4 decoder card, but it also provides a set of analog inputs for video processing of various input sources. This solution combines the power of sophisticated deinterlacing, video processing and scaling capability of the DScaler software, and represents a revolution in the HTPC (home theater PC) history. The result turns a personal computer into a high performance digital media player and video processor/scaler and delivers unprecedented high quality video in home theaters.

Input Specifications:
One Parallel Digital Interface (PDI) Three RCA sockets can be used as:
-One component
-Three composites
-RGB(Sync on Green)
-RGBS (SCART) - One S-video is
used for sync input
Two S-videos - Each S-video can be used as
two composite inputs*
*S-video to composite conversion cables are not included

System Requirements:
Intel P4 1GHz or higher, or compatible
computer
One available PCI 2.1 compliant slot Realmagic Xcard or 100% compatible
MPEG2/MPEG4 decoder card
An AGP video card DRAM: 128MB or moreExtra disk space: 10MB or more Microsoft Windows 98/ME/2000/XPGraphic subsystem with DirectX 8.0 or higher
